How We Remove Water from Foundation Leaks
When you call us,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that gets your property back to normal as quickly as possible. Here’s an overview of what you can expect from our team:
Step 1: Emergency Response
Within 60 minutes of your call, our emergency response team will arrive on site to assess the damage and begin the water removal process. We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water, and our technicians will be equipped with the necessary gear to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area, including our truck-mounted water extraction units that can handle up to 2,000 gallons of water per hour.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been removed, our technicians will use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ry out the area, ensuring that your property is safe and healthy to occupy.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area, including walls, floors, and any other surfaces that may have come into contact with the water.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air
Once the cleaning and disinfecting process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is done right and that your property is safe and secure.

Warning Signs of Foundation Leak Water Damage
Ignoring warning signs of foundation leak water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A musty smell in your basement or crawlspace can show a foundation leak. Don’t ignore it,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ors
Water stains or warping on walls or floors can be a sign of a foundation leak. Get it checked out by a professional to prevent further damage.
Spongy or Soft Flooring
Spongy or soft flooring can show that your floor has come into contact with water. Get it checked out by a professional to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Bills or Increased Water Usage
Unexplained bills or increased water usage can show a foundation leak. Get it checked out by a professional to prevent further damage.
Visible Leaks or Water Damage
Visible leaks or water damage can be a sign of a foundation leak. Get it checked out by a professional to prevent further damage.

Foundation Leak Water Removal Cost in Graham, WA
The cost of foundation leak water removal in Graham, WA can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ates are based on the following sc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the leak, size of the affected area, and local conditions. |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s. |
| Final Inspection and Repair |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s. |
